London, June 17 (IANS) Indian-born Amol Rajan has been appointed editor of the London morning daily The Independent, making him Fleet Street’s first non-white editor, the newspaper reported Monday. New Delhi, June 17 (IANS) Formula 1 team Marussia has handed Tio Ellinas of Cyprus his first Formula 1 test. The Marussia young driver programme member Ellinas will conduct a scheduled straight-line aerodynamic evaluation with the team at United Kingdom’s Kemble Airfield Tuesday. New Delhi, June 17 (IANS) Congressman Mallikarjun Kharge will be the new Railways minister while Rajasthan MP Girija Vyas will replace Ajay Maken as the housing and poverty alleviation minister. Chennai, June 17 (IANS) Tamil Nadu Chief Minister J. Jayalalithaa Monday reshuffled her cabinet, dropping two ministers and adding two, and also reallocating three portfolios.
